Calculate Log Base 150 of 242

To solve the equation log 150 (242)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 242, a = 150:
    log 150 (242) = log(242) / log(150)
  3. Evaluate the term:
    log(242) / log(150)
    = 1.39794000867204 / 1.92427928606188
    = 1.0954574428165
    = Logarithm of 242 with base 150
